THE ROLE
In this role you will join our forward leaning and high performing finance department that is responsible for the overall financial strategy, reporting, statutory reporting and internal reporting of Haypp Group. The finance department is responsible for developing and implementing routines and processes to ensure timely and accurate reporting within the group.
As Financial Controller you’ll be responsible for supporting the business areas and functions within Haypp Group to ensure that rules and routines are followed and adhered to. You will be focusing on financial accounting for the group’s local subsidiaries across all countries we operate in. This includes both statutory reporting and the internal reporting (toward group consolidation and business controls), and for developing and implementing routines and processes to ensure timely and accurate monthly closures. In addition you’ll be expected to keep yourself updated on laws and regulations within the finance area and ensure improvement and development to our ways of working.
Your work tasks will mainly be focused on the following
- Revenue
- COGS
- Inventory
- Intercompany
- Salary accounting
- Swedish Annual reports
- Ad hoc tasks such as projects etc.
ABOUT YOU
We believe that you are currently working as a Financial Controller or in a similar role and want to join a company that is doing a difference in the world. As a person you are structured, analytical and have the ability to prioritize and handle a dynamic work environment. In addition you love having fun at work - we know that we do!
Basic qualifications to succeed in the role:
- At least 5 years of accounting experience
- Solid experience in inventory accounting and revenue recognition accounting
- Experience of FMCG or similar industry
- Good Swedish and English
- Very good MS Office
- Good communication skills
